Output 323e93fbac09b4ba7c160eb1a201149ce3dfd8044b364a19be2fb769b8b3dea4:2

value
2684389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ed30b803f9b49b1d23dc47d65ee61091d2653d OP_EQUAL
address
3NNtnAkZH5F6GdviRUTafzEcxWabEMGdwn
transaction
323e93fbac09b4ba7c160eb1a201149ce3dfd8044b364a19be2fb769b8b3dea4